Where are you going, New Work?

A conversation with Prof. Jan Teunen and Michael Trautmann

How will we work in the future? In the resonance lab of combine Consulting, we explore these questions and invite exciting guests to share their perspectives. In this episode, two well-known voices from the world of work meet: Prof. Jan Teunen and Michael Trautmann. Together with combine managing director Matthias Pietzcker, they discuss how work is changing, what role technology plays, and why offices need to be more than just places of efficiency.

What it's about

It quickly becomes clear in the conversation: The way Frithjof Bergmann once coined the term „New Work,“ it is no longer understood everywhere today. Home office and remote work have taken precedence in the discussion about meaningful work. Is this really effective on the path to the future of work?

Michael Trautmann, co-founder of the podcast „On the Way to New Work,“ talks about the rapid technological developments – from artificial intelligence and robotics to new forms of organization – and their impact on the world of work.

Prof. Jan Teunen brings the perspective of value-oriented leadership and its idea of „offices as greenhouses for potential development.“.

The discussion revolves around central questions:

  • How is AI changing our work – is it taking burdens off our shoulders or isolating us?
  • Why isn't it enough to talk about remote work and fancy furniture when it comes to New Work Are we going?
  • What role do encounter, co-creation, and beauty play in the design of work environments?
  • How can companies create a work culture that strengthens motivation and mental health?

 

The conclusion of the episode is optimistic: there will always be work – the challenge lies in shaping it in such a way that it empowers people, provides meaning, and opens up spaces where the future can grow.
